Weenzee Review – The Company
When you land on the website, you noticed there is no information on who runs or owns the company.
After checking out the Weenzee website domain information on “weenzee.com” I found out it was registered August 15th, 2018.
Mareks Pavolvskis is the owner through a virtual off address in London, UK.
Hey, at least it wasn’t privately registered…
Other than the UK incorporation records, there is no information on this Pavolvskis fella…
I am not even sure if he exists…
A lot of YouTube channels on Weenzee shows it was heavily marketed in Asia first.
The top traffic comes from Brazil, Iran and India.
There is one video about the grand opening of Weenzee and it was help in Berlin, Germany.
Looks like this company could be just European judging by the people in the video.

Weenzee Compensation Plan
The funny part is there is a ton of information about the actual compensation plan but nothing else…
Weenzee members invest in WNZ points on a promise they will get an ROI of some kind.
At the time of this article, WNZ points are not publicly traded and the internal value is set by Weenzee.
Basically, they sell them at whatever value you feel like choosing.
Once invested, WNZ points are parked for 30 to 365 days.
- Invest WNZ points for 30 days and receive a 0.73% daily ROI
- Invest WNZ points for 60 days and receive a 0.88% daily ROI
- Invest WNZ points for 90 days and receive a 0.91% daily ROI
- Invest WNZ points for 180 days and receive a 0.95% daily ROI
- Invest WNZ points for 365 days and receive a 0.99% daily ROI
Daily return on this can be increased according to rank:
- User (Get started and invest in WNZ points) – base return amounts above
- User+ (invest at least $100 and generate $300 or more from a total downline of 10 or more investors) – bonus 1% a day
- WeenA (personally invest at least $300 and produce $5000 from a total downline of 30 or more investors) – bonus 3% a day
- WeenB (personally invest at least $1000 and produce $10,000 from a total downline of 100 or more investors) – bonus 5% a day
- WeenC (personally invest at least $3000 and produce $100,000 from a total downline of 1000 or more investors) – bonus 7% a day
- Leader (personally invest at least $10,000 and produce $1,000,000 from a total downline of 3000 or more investors) – bonus 10% a day
- Leader Pro (personally invest at least $50,000 and produce $10,000,000 from a total downline of 5000 or more investors) – bonus 15% a day
- WeenZee (personally invest at least $500,000 and produce $100,000,000 from a total downline of 50,000 or more investors) – bonus 20% a day
Referral Commissions
Weenzee pays all referral commissions through a unilevel compensation plan structure.
Residual commissions is paid on a percentage of the invested funds of your downline members that are eight levels deep.
The amount of levels you get paid will depend on your rank:
- Users earn 3% on level 1 (Personally sponsored affiliates), 2% on level 2, and 1% on level 3
- User+ affiliates earn 3% on level 1, 2% on level 2 and 1% on levels 3 and 4
- WeenA affiliates earn 3% on level 1, 2% on level 2, 1% on levels 3 and 4 and 0.5% on level 5
- WeenB affiliates earn 5% on level 1, 3% on level 2, 1% on levels 3 and 4 and 0.5% on levels 5 and 6
- WeenC affiliates earn 5% on level 1, 3% on level 2, 2% on level 3, 1% on levels 4 and 5 and 0.5% on levels 6 and 7
- Leaders and higher earn 7% on level 1, 3% on level 2, 2% on level 3, 1% on levels 4 and 5 and 0.5% on levels 6 to 8

Final Verdict
So does the Weenzee scam exist?
Well let’s look at some of the facts shall we?
The company owner(s) are not transparent about themselves and there isn’t any real information out there other than a bogus name.
WNZ points are useless outside of the company and the admin(s) can set whatever value they want internally.
In other words, you are investing in air…
Last but not least, they promise guarantee ROI’s which is a big no no in regulatory standpoint.
Plus they have no evidence of external income fueling those ROI’s which leads to only one thing…
Newly invested funds are paying off existing members which makes this nothing more than a Ponzi scheme.
To keep this company alive until they exit, they claim the following:
ON WHICH EXCHANGES A COIN LISTING IS PLANNED?
We are already negotiating with the Asian and European stock exchanges on the listing of the WNZ unit.
The most up-to-date information will be posted with a list of connected exchanges on the page “Exchanges” (it is planned in 2019).
It’s basically an attempt to keep the hopes up of the investors…
